Output a59ee720e8f31db8b99607152bcaa02d2818004a651e65ea030767e5fbca4c9a:1

value
135538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5176f6205588a60853bb6145f402af11368d8bc OP_EQUAL
address
3Kf97dfME2LrtcCMsSKR7XXimEKXUYhhZz
transaction
a59ee720e8f31db8b99607152bcaa02d2818004a651e65ea030767e5fbca4c9a
spent
true